824 FNUS73 KDTX 191321 FWSDTX Spot Forecast for Deford Oaks...MIDNR National Weather Service Detroit/Pontiac MI 921 AM EDT Mon May 19 2025 Forecast is based on forecast start time of 1400 EDT on May 19. If conditions become unrepresentative...contact the National Weather Service. .DISCUSSION...High pressure will expand across northern Ontario during the next couple of days. Northerly winds associated with this system will sustain cool temperatures across the southern lakes. Ample cloud cover today will keep min rh values relatively high. Sunny skies on Monday will drop daytime rh values into the 30s. A low pressure system forecast to track across the Ohio Valley Tuesday into Wednesday will bring the next chance of rain to the area. .REST OF TODAY... Sky/weather.........Sunny (15-25 percent). Max temperature.....Around 56. Min humidity........43 percent. Surface winds (mph).North winds around 13 mph with gusts to around 24 mph. Dewpoint............34. Eye level winds.....Northeast winds around 10 mph with gusts to around 19 mph. Mixing height.......3400 ft AGL. Transport winds.....North 15 to 16 mph. Smoke Dispersal....Good (MAX...481). Sky/weather.........Mostly clear (15-25 percent). Patchy frost overnight. Areas of frost overnight. Min temperature.....Around 35. Max humidity........85 percent. Surface winds (mph).Northeast winds 5 to 12 mph. Gusts up to 23 mph early in the evening. Dewpoint............30. Eye level winds.....Northeast winds up to 10 mph. Gusts up to 23 mph early in the evening. Mixing height.......400 ft AGL. Transport winds.....Northeast 9 to 16 mph...becoming east 13 to 15 mph after 3 am. Smoke Dispersal....Poor (MIN...40). Sky/weather.........Mostly sunny (40-50 percent)becoming mostly cloudy (65-75 percent). Areas of frost early in the morning. Max temperature.....Around 59. Min humidity........40 percent. Surface winds (mph).East winds 8 to 15 mph. Gusts up to 26 mph. Dewpoint............33...increasing to 36 late in the afternoon. Eye level winds.....East winds 6 to 12 mph. Gusts up to 26 mph. Mixing height.......2900 ft AGL. Transport winds.....East 15 to 21 mph. Smoke Dispersal....Good (MAX...518).
